I used to windsurf quite abit all along the coast. There is a darn good possibility that it will be windy as snot that time of year at Jalama. It could also be calm. Any later in the spring and there would be 80% chance of it being blown out. It is considered one of top spring time sailboard spots in California. We are talking 20 knots sideshore by late morning. If a gathering is planned for that time close attention to wind forecasts would be the call.
